Inline function cannot access non-public-API: @PublishedApi vs @Suppress vs @JvmSynthetic

@PublishedApi internal is the intended way of exposing non-public API for use in public inline functions.

That @PublishedApi internal member becomes effectively public and its name doesn’t get mangled (if you noticed the opposite, please file a bug).

@Suppress("NON_PUBLIC_CALL_FROM_PUBLIC_INLINE") is a band-aid workaround in the lack of @PublishedApi based on suppressing an error and therefore isn’t recommended. With the introduction of @PublishedApi this suppression is going to be cleaned from the standard library.

@JvmSynthetic combined with @PublishedApi is an interesting approach, however it can cause some problems while debugging, though I’m not sure.
